Other notable announcements and developments today…

• Alex Vlassopulos, formerly off of digital music service provider Omnifone, has joined Google in a business development role within its Google Play wing, after just under a year as VP Of Business Development over at Rdio.

• Peugeot’s new Fractal concept car features sound design by Amon Tobin. The producer has created a sound that “plays when the driver opens the doors using the smartwatch remote system. What follows is a unique electric coupé driving experience offering a wealth of sensory exploration”. Yeah.

• Over a year since he ‘moved on’ from Syco, 2012 ‘X-Factor’ winner James Arthur has revealed on Twitter that he has signed a new major label record deal and will release a new album in 2016.

• Ólafur Arnalds and Nils Frahm will release their third collaborative EP on 2 Oct. ‘Loon’ will feature five synth-based compositions. This is one of them, called ‘Four’.
